Professional Career

He made his first professional debut on 3rd December 1994, for World Wrestling Association in Clementon, New Jersey, in a loss against WWA Heavyweight Champion Frank Finnegan.

Meanwhile, his first match in WWA turned out to be his only match for the promotion as well. After that, he signed a lucrative contract with WCW in 1995.

Later on, he debuted under the ring name The Giant and had his first match for the promotion at the 1995 Halloween Havoc, against WCW World Heavyweight Champion Hogan.

After that, he joined the stable in 1996 and was part of the stable until December.

At that time, he won the battle royal at World War 3 and tried to challenge Hogan for a World Heavyweight title match.

Wight had become disillusioned with his prospect in WCW in 1999. Meanwhile, he had realized that he was making significantly lesser money than the main wrestlers and let his contract with the promotion expire.

He became a free agent on 8th February 1999 and later he joined WWF after signing a ten-year contract with the promotion and later adopted the ring name ‘Big Show’. Additionally, he feuded with The Rock, Kane, The Undertaker, and McMahon himself and was briefly in alliance with The Undertaker.

Big Show won the WWF Championship for the first time, defeating The Rock and Triple H at the 1999 Survivor Series. After that, he came back at the 2001 Royal Rumble and played a significant role in The Invasion storyline.

More Career

Big Show defeated Brock Lesnar to become the WWE Champion for the second time at the 2002 Survivor Series. After that, he lost the belt a month later to Kurt Angle.
Additionally, he won the United States Championship from Eddie Guerrero at the 2003 No Mercy.
Meanwhile, he was defeated by Japanese sumo legend Akebono in a worked sumo match at WrestleMania 21.

He began working with Kane in October 2005. They won the World Tag Team Championship but later start a feud that would result in two no-contest matches. Furthermore, he won the ECW World Heavyweight Championship on 4th July 2006.

Later on, he returned to WWE and in 2011, reunited with Kane. Additionally, he won the World Heavyweight Championship for the first time at the 2011 TLC: Tables, Ladders & Chairs.

After taking a leave from professional wrestling in September 2017, he had surgery. Furthermore, he returned on 4th April 2018, to induct his long-time friend Mark Henry into the WWE Hall of Fame.

At present, he is signed to All Elite Wrestling (AEW) as an in-ring performer, and as a commentator for its web television show, AEW Dark: Elevation, under his real name of Paul Wight.

Acting Career

Big Show made his film debut in the 1996 sports drama ‘Reggie’s Prayer’, portraying a character named Mr. Portola.

Although, he worked with Arnold Schwarzenegger, Sinbad, and Phil Hartman in the Christmas family action comedy-drama ‘Jingle All the Way’.

He appeared in two films in 1998. His first movie was the action-comedy ‘McKinsey’s Island’, in which he co-starred with Hulk Hogan.

After that, he then portrayed Adam Sandler’s idol, Captain Insano, in the highly successful sports comedy ‘The Waterboy’. Meanwhile, his next film was the 2006 family film ‘Little Hercules in 3-D’.

Additionally, Wight was cast as Brick Hughes in the 2010 action-comedy ‘MacGruber’. He acted in many movies such as ‘Vendetta’ in 2015 ‘And countdown’ in 2016.

Although, he also voiced a character based on his professional wrestling personality in ‘The Jetsons & WWE: Robo-WrestleMania!

Furthermore, Wight has made guest appearances on several TV shows, including ‘Shasta McNasty’ (1999), ‘Star Trek: Enterprise’ (2004), and ‘Psych’ (2013).
